Æthelwine Heardesunu is a Tretridian politician and diplomat who is one of the Deputy Secretary-Generals of the League of Novaris, is Chairman of the LN Foreign Office, and served Secretary-General of the League from 2020 to 2022.
Heardesunu spent most of his career serving in the Tretridian foreign service, and rose to prominence during his tenure while Ambassador to Celanora, during which Tretridio-Celanoran relations improved substantially. Heardesunu was elected to the Witenagemot in 2001. He served as Minister of Foreign Affairs from 2003-2009, and was instrumental in implementing the foreign policy of Osbeorn Cynricesunu's government.
In his role as Ambassador-at-Large to Novaris from 2017 to 2019, he served as chief advisor to Eoforwine Æthelstanesunu regarding Novaran affairs, most visibly with his role in the creation of the League of Novaris. He would concurrently serve as Ambassador-at-Large and as the Permanent Representative to the League of Novaris until his election to the position of LN Secretary-General in 2020
As Secretary-General, Heardesunu lead the League through a series of major international incidents, including the Rodenian invasion of Puntalia and the Correvan crisis. His denunciation of Eoforwine Æthelstanesunu at the start of his second term as Secretary-General marked a significant turn in relations between Tretrid and the League.
After stepping down from his position as Secretary-General at the end of his second term in June 2022, Heardesunu was invited to serve as the Chair of the LN's Foreign Office by Thomas Lind, and was named Deputy Secretary-General along with Bob Peare by Shano Tuvria, becoming the first former Secreatry-General to serve as Deputy, as well as being one of the first Deputies to serve alongside another Deputy.
Early life and education
Heardesunu was born on December 4, 1961, and grew up in Sigested.
He attended the University of Cynebury from 1980 to 1984, where he majored in international relations. While he scored high-marks, people around him later recalled that he was "a heavy partier" who "played as hard as he worked." Heardesunu would later express his "regrets" about the way he acted as a university student, stating that "that past version of [him] almost seems like a completely different person." Heardesunu also competed on the University of Cynebury's varsity skeet shooting team. He graduated with a BA magna cum laude in June 1984.
Early career
Heardesunu joined the Royal Diplomatic Service immediately after graduating in 1984 and initially served as an attaché to the Embassy of Tretrid, Solevia, in Solevera. Upon his recommendation to the position by the Tretridian Ambassador to Solevera, in 1990, Heardesunu was appointed as Consul of the Tretridian consulate in Cilèmonte, Celanora.
Ambassador to Celanora
The Ambassador-at-Large to Novaris submitted his intent to retire from the Royal Diplomatic Service in late 1996, leading Prime Minister Ecgswið Eohbeornesdohter to appoint the Ambassador to Celanora to fulfill the position. The Ambassador to Celanora recommended Heardesunu to the position of Ambassador, noting that his "due diligence in effecting Tretridian foreign policy in his consular assignment" made him an "exemplary" candidate for the assignment. Eohbeornesdohter chose to follow the recommendation and nominated Heardesunu to be the next Ambassador to Celanora, and he was confirmed by the Witenagemot on April 26, 1996. He delivered his letter of credence to the three Celanoran Triarchs on May 10, and took office upon the acceptance of his diplomatic credentials.

Personal life
Heardesunu met Cuðþryð Wynstansdohter when the two were undergraduate students at the University of Cynebury in 1981. The two started dating about a year after Heardesunu joined the Royal Diplomatic Service, and the two became engaged in 1986, after Wynstansdohter received her PhD in Chemical Engineering from the University of Cynebury. They married in 1987.
Heardesunu has two children, Ceolswið Æthelwinesdohter and Eadwine Æthelwinesunu.
